<P>PROBLEM TO BE SOLVED: To reduce deterioration of a reception signal by decreasing effects of signal distortion that may occur during the gain adjustment of a receiving section in a radar device. <P>SOLUTION: A pulse signal is generated as a transmission signal by a pulse generator 101 and transmitted from an antenna 104 iteratively at fixed time intervals. A reception signal, which is received by the antenna 106, containing a reflection wave from an object is amplified by an amplifier 107, a gain adjustment is performed thereon by a variable attenuator 108, and a reception pulse of the reflection wave is then detected by a distance detector 111 to calculate a distance to the object. The variable attenuator 108 attenuates the reception signal with a gain adjusted in accordance with a gain control signal from a gain adjuster 113. The gain (attenuation amount) of the variable attenuator 108 is controlled to be maximum just after transmission of the pulse signal and to become smaller with the passage of time. Furthermore, gain adjustment timing to change the attenuation amount is made different each time the pulse signal is transmitted, on the basis of a gain adjustment timing signal from a timing adjuster 112. <P>COPYRIGHT: (C)2012,JPO&INPIT |
